You might remember the sheer panic (excuse the pun) that occurred last year when Ed Sheeran tickets went on sale for his upcoming European tour.
A month ago, Anne Marie announced that she would be supporting the singer for this year’s concerts but now a second act has been announced.
Jamie Lawson is also set to join the Rockabye singer/songwriter and Ed, gearing up for some brilliant performances.
Jamie shared the news on Twitter this morning and it’s clear he’s over the moon at the chance to join two major musical talents in what’s a pretty impressive lineup.

The Plymouth native is best known for Wasn’t Expecting That, which was an absolutely massive hit in Ireland in 2011.
Jamie is the first musician to sign to Ed’s own record label, Gingerbread Records, and the pals go way back having played together a number of times.

The Irish dates, all of which have now sold out, take place on:
Fri 4 May – Páirc Uí Chaoimh, Cork
Sat 5 May – Páirc Uí Chaoimh, Cork
Sun 6 May – Páirc Uí Chaoimh, Cork
Wed 9 May – Boucher Playing Fields, Belfast
Sat 12 May – Pearse Stadium, Galway
Sun 13 May – Pearse Stadium, Galway
Wed 16 May – Phoenix Park, Dublin
Fri 18 May – Phoenix Park, Dublin
Sat 19 May – Phoenix Park, Dublin
